The video discusses the Federal Reserve's inflation target and the importance of real rates being positive. It highlights the market's perception of the Fed's credibility in controlling inflation and the challenges of labor participation post-COVID. The discussion shifts to the risks associated with investment grade and high yield sectors, particularly in the context of interest rate hikes. The video concludes with an analysis of the Chinese property market, noting potential consolidation and recovery opportunities.
